Top 10 Tips On Assessing The Data Sources And Quality Of Ai Trading Platforms For Stock Prediction And Analysis.
To enable AI-driven trading platforms and stock prediction systems to deliver accurate and reliable insights, it is essential that they assess the accuracy of the data they use. Inaccurate data can lead to poor predictions, financial losses or a lack of trust toward the platform. Here are the top 10 suggestions on evaluating the quality of data and its sources.
1. Verify the data sources
Check where the data comes from: Be sure to use reputable and well known data providers.
Transparency: The platform needs to be transparent about the sources of its data and update them regularly.
Avoid dependence on a single source: Trustworthy platforms integrate information from multiple sources in order to minimize errors and biases.
2. Check the Freshness of Data
Real-time data as opposed to. data delayed Find out if your platform has real-time or delayed data. Real-time is important for active trading. However, delayed data may be sufficient to be used for long-term analysis.
Update frequency: Make sure to check the frequency with which data is changed.
Accuracy of historical data Be sure the information is correct and reliable.
3. Evaluate Data Completeness
Check for missing data: Look for gaps in historical data as well as tickers that are not working or financial statements that are not complete.
Coverage. Check that your platform has a wide range of markets, stocks, and indices that are relevant to your trading strategy.
Corporate actions: Make sure the platform can take into account stock splits and dividends. Also, check if it accounts for mergers.
4. Accuracy of Test Data
Cross-verify your data: Check the platform's data against other trusted sources.
Error detection: Watch out for a mismatch in pricing, incorrect financial metrics or unusual outliers.
Backtesting: You may use old data to test trading strategies. Examine if they meet your expectations.
5. Granularity of data is determined
Detail: Make sure the platform provides granular data, such as intraday prices, volume, bid-ask spreads, and order book depth.
Financial metrics: Find out whether your platform provides detailed financial reports (income statement and balance sheet) and key ratios such as P/E/P/B/ROE. ).
6. Make sure that the data processing is checked and Cleaning
Data normalization - Ensure your platform normalizes your data (e.g. adjusts for splits or dividends). This will help ensure the consistency.
Handling outliers (handling anomalies): Verify that the platform is able to handle anomalies and outliers.
Missing data imputation Verify that your system uses reliable methods when filling in the missing data.
7. Examine data consistency
Aligning data to the time zone: To avoid discrepancies, ensure that all data is in sync with each other.
Format consistency: Check if the data is formatted in a consistent format (e.g. units, currency).
Cross-market consistency: Verify that data from multiple markets or exchanges is harmonized.
8. Determine the relevancy of data
Relevance to your strategy for trading The data you are using is compatible with your style of trading (e.g. analytical techniques quantitative modeling, fundamental analysis).
Feature selection: Verify whether the platform provides relevant features to enhance forecasts (e.g. sentiment analysis, macroeconomic indicator and news data).
Examine Data Security Integrity
Data encryption: Ensure that your system is using encryption to safeguard data during transmission and storage.
Tamperproofing: Check that the data isn't altered or manipulated.
Conformity: See whether the platform is in compliance with data protection regulations.
10. Transparency of the AI model's performance on the Platform can be testable
Explainability: Ensure that the platform provides you with insights into the AI model's use of data to formulate predictions.
Bias detection: Find out if the platform actively monitors and corrects biases within the model or data.
Performance metrics - Evaluate the platform's track record as well as its performance metrics (e.g. : accuracy, precision and recall) to assess the reliability of their predictions.
Bonus Tips
Reputation and reviews of users Review feedback from users and reviews in order to assess the reliability of the platform and the data quality.
Trial period: Try the platform free of charge to see how it works and what features are offered before you commit.
Customer support: Ensure the platform has a solid customer support to resolve issues related to data.
These guidelines will assist you evaluate the quality of data and the sources that are used by AI stock prediction platforms. This will help you to make more educated decisions about trading. Top 10 Tips For Evaluating The Scalability Ai Analysis Of Trading Platforms And Stock Prediction
To make sure that AI-driven prediction and trading platforms are able to handle the growing amount of data, user requests, and market complexity, it is vital to determine their capacity. Here are 10 top methods to evaluate scalability.
1. Evaluate Data Handling Capacity
Tips : Find out if the platform has the capability to process and analyze large data sets.
The reason: Scalable systems need to handle data volumes that are growing without performance degradation.
2. Test the capabilities of a Real-Time Processor
Find out how your platform handles real-time streams of data, like live stock quotes or breaking news.
Why: The real-time analysis of trading decisions is crucial since delays can cause you to miss opportunities.
3. Cloud Infrastructure Elasticity and Check
Tips: Determine whether the platform has the ability to dynamically scale resources and uses cloud infrastructure (e.g. AWS Cloud, Google Cloud, Azure).
Why? Cloud platforms are flexible, and can be scalable up or down in response to the demand.
4. Algorithm Efficiency
Tip 1: Examine the computational performance of the AI models being used (e.g. reinforcement learning deep learning, etc.).
Why: Complex algoriths can be resource intensive So the ability to optimize these algorithms is crucial for scalability.
5. Explore Parallel Processing and distributed computing
Tip: Determine if a platform makes use of parallel processing and distributed computing frameworks.
What are they: These technologies facilitate quicker data processing and analysis across many nodes.
Review API Integration, and Interoperability
Tip : Make sure your platform integrates with other APIs, such as market data providers or brokerage APIs.
The reason: seamless platform integration makes sure it is able to adapt to new sources of data or trading environment.
7. Analyze User Load Handling
Tip: Simulate high users to gauge how the platform performs under stress.
The reason: A platform that is scalable should maintain performance even as the number of users grows.
8. Evaluation of Model Retraining and the Adaptability
Tips: Find out how frequently and effectively the AI models are trained with new data.
The reason is that markets change and models have to change quickly to keep their precision.
9. Verify Fault Tolerance and Redundancy
Tips: Ensure that your platform is equipped with failover mechanisms to handle hardware or software failures.
Why: Because downtime can be expensive when trading Fault tolerance is a must to scalability.
10. Monitor Cost Efficiency
Tips: Calculate the costs of the expansion of your platform. Consider cloud resources, storage for data and computational power.
Reason: Scalability should not come at an unsustainable cost, so balancing performance and expense is essential.
Bonus tip Future-proofing
Assuring that the platform will be able to accommodate emerging technologies (e.g. advanced NLP, quantum computing) as well as regulatory changes.
These factors can assist you in assessing the scaleability of AI-powered stock prediction as well as trading platforms. They'll also be sure they're reliable efficient, reliable capable of expansion and are future-proof.
